Output 577d14239e30cc97e2b474c7c68e92ee40446f61fe04196751a086cb0dafd9aa:1

value
1140676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9439c55fb819e21449e511e2a521fb110505a38c OP_EQUAL
address
3FCm8w6fuTTuXYoQS5VppoLd56t2LeZhjK
transaction
577d14239e30cc97e2b474c7c68e92ee40446f61fe04196751a086cb0dafd9aa